| LAST ACTION: | Effective Ninety Days from Passage - (June 10, 2016) |
| SUMMARY: | Clarifying that optometrists may continue to exercise the same prescriptive authority which they possessed prior to hydrocodone being reclassified |
| LEAD SPONSOR: |
Householder |
| SPONSORS: | Faircloth, Rodighiero, Campbell, Perry, White, B. |
